1) Gravity Forms

Gravity Forms is a robust tool for building contact forms on real estate websites.

Its drag-and-drop interface simplifies crafting custom forms without needing to code.

This feature is particularly beneficial for real estate agents who need to frequently update listings or capture client information efficiently.

One of the standout features of Gravity Forms is its extensive collection of form fields.

You can include fields for capturing various data such as property addresses, viewing preferences, client contact information, and more.

This tool also supports conditional logic, allowing you to display or hide fields based on user input.

With Gravity Forms, you can enable file uploads, which is ideal for clients submitting documents or images related to properties.

This capability can streamline the process of collecting necessary documentation.

For those interested in integrating with other platforms, Gravity Forms offers numerous add-ons.

These add-ons can connect your real estate contact forms with email marketing services, payment gateways, and CRM systems to enhance workflow automation.

3) Contact Form 7

A modern real estate website with four contact form builders displayed on a computer screen

Contact Form 7 is a widely used WordPress plugin, perfect for enhancing real estate websites with flexible contact forms.

As a free tool, it appeals to many businesses looking for cost-effective solutions.

This plugin lets you customize forms to suit your real estate needs, allowing easy integration of fields to gather important client information.

It supports various input types like text boxes and dropdowns, ensuring you capture all essential details.

Another advantage is its compatibility with other WordPress plugins, offering an adaptable experience.

This allows integration with tools that enhance functionality, such as spam filters, ensuring seamless client communication.

Contact Form 7 includes useful features such as CAPTCHA and Akismet spam filtering to protect from unwanted submissions.

It provides a robust and efficient solution for maintaining clean and relevant client interactions.

The plugin might require some technical knowledge for setup but offers a straightforward interface for managing forms once configured.

Its flexibility is ideal for tailoring to specific needs, making it suitable for your real estate business.

4) Ninja Forms

A modern real estate office with a sleek, minimalist design.</p><p>A computer screen displays the Ninja Forms 4 Contact Form Builder open on a real estate website

Ninja Forms is an excellent choice for real estate websites looking for a versatile and user-friendly contact form builder.

With its drag-and-drop editor, you can effortlessly design mobile-responsive forms that match your site’s aesthetic.

The flexibility of Ninja Forms allows you to integrate various add-ons for enhanced functionality.

Whether you need CRM integration, email marketing tools, or payment processing features, it’s equipped to handle your needs.

Spam protection and GDPR compliance are built-in, ensuring that both your data and the information of your clients remain secure.

With over a million active installations, it’s a reliable option for real estate professionals who prioritize efficiency.

Ninja Forms also supports a variety of third-party plugins, which means you can customize it further to suit your unique business needs.

Frequent updates ensure compatibility with the latest WordPress versions, which means you can expect ongoing support.

Optimizing Form Fields for User Experience

Streamlining form fields can significantly enhance the user experience.

Limit the number of fields to only what’s necessary, such as name, email, and message.

Optional fields can include phone numbers or property preferences but avoid overwhelming the user with too many requests.

Use dropdown menus or checkboxes to simplify input options where possible.

Label each field clearly, and provide brief instructions or examples as needed.

This will not only improve form completion rates but also ensure that the data collected is useful and relevant for your business.

Ensuring Mobile Responsiveness

With a growing number of users accessing websites via mobile devices, ensuring mobile responsiveness is crucial.

Design forms that resize and adjust seamlessly to various screen sizes without sacrificing functionality.

Test the forms on multiple devices to confirm usability and appearance are consistent.

Use large enough buttons for easy tapping and ensure that text fields are not too close together to avoid accidental interactions.

Implement auto-fill options to reduce the time and effort required to complete the forms on small screens.

These practices help in capturing leads efficiently and maintaining user interest, no matter how they’re accessing your site.
